Comprehending Refractive Surgical Procedure Treatments



When thinking about refractive surgical treatment treatments, it's essential to understand exactly how they can improve your vision.

These methods focus on fixing typical vision problems like nearsightedness, hyperopia, and astigmatism. You'll typically run into techniques such as LASIK, PRK, and SMILE, each using advanced modern technology to change the form of your cornea.

Benefits and Risks of Refractive Surgery



While refractive surgical procedure can supply life-changing advantages, it's important to weigh these against the prospective threats involved. Many individuals experience boosted vision, reduced dependence on glasses or get in touch with lenses, and boosted quality of life. You may locate everyday tasks, like driving or exercising, a lot easier without aesthetic help.

Nevertheless, threats such as completely dry eyes, glow, halos, or perhaps vision loss can take place. It's vital to have realistic assumptions and understand that results can differ. Not everyone is an ideal prospect, and pre-existing problems can make complex outcomes.

Consulting with your eye care expert will certainly assist you examine whether the benefits surpass the risks in your certain case, guiding you towards a knowledgeable choice.

Recuperation and Aftercare for Refractive Surgical Treatment



After undergoing refractive surgical procedure, you'll require to concentrate on a proper healing and aftercare regular to guarantee the best possible results.



Right after the procedure, you might experience some pain, yet it is necessary to follow your surgeon's instructions. Usage prescribed eye decreases to prevent infection and lower swelling. Stay clear of rubbing your eyes and put on protective eyewear as recommended.

Resting your eyes is critical; limit screen time and brilliant lights for the initial few days. Go to all follow-up consultations to check your recovery procedure.

You may notice changes in your vision at first, yet this is regular. Remain hydrated and preserve a healthy diet to support recovery.
